Beijing: Renmin tiyu chubanshe,, 1976. A well-preserved and eye-catching Cultural Revolution poster celebrating the virtues of revolutionary enthusiasm and dedication in China's youth. Although this was one of 100,000 copies produced for the first printing, only a fraction survive in collectable condition. Throughout the Mao period, propaganda posters and publications portrayed teenagers and young adults as the builders of China's socialist tomorrow, urging them to dedicate themselves to making revolution in the face of all adversity. During the Cultural Revolution, after the heady radicalism of the Red Guard movement, Mao sanctioned the rustication of large numbers of students to the countryside to restore order in urban areas. Posters such as the present dramatic example aimed to pacify a youth generation feeling increasingly disillusioned with and alienated from the Communist project. Though not marked as such, the present copy is from the library of Paul Pickowicz (b. 1945), a notable scholar of modern Chinese culture and society. In 1971, Pickowicz was one of 15 American scholars invited to visit the mainland, the delegation being the first group of American academics to set foot in Mao's China. Poster (767 x 1062 mm), showing a young Red Guard swimming in waves alongside fellow revolutionaries. Edges toned and lightly creased, chip and two small closed tears to upper margin not affecting image. In near-fine condition.
